What is the Utah Individual Income Tax Return 2010?

The Utah Individual Income Tax Return 2010, also known as TC-40, is a crucial state tax form for residents of Utah. This document enables taxpayers to report their annual income, determine the tax owed, and fulfill state tax obligations. Individuals must understand the significance of this form to ensure compliance with Utah tax regulations.
The form is essential for calculating taxable income, claiming deductions, and making any necessary contributions to state funds. Knowing how to complete the TC-40 accurately can help avoid penalties and ensure timely filing.

Eligibility includes residents of Utah who have earned income in 2010 and need to report it for state tax purposes. Both individuals and married couples filing jointly can use this form.
Typically, the deadline to submit the Utah Individual Income Tax Return is April 15, following the tax year. Check state resources for any possible extensions or changes.
You can submit your completed Utah Individual Income Tax Return either electronically through the state’s e-filing system or by mailing a printed copy to the designated state tax office.
Supporting documents may include W-2 forms, 1099s for other income, receipts for deductions, and any forms that verify contributions to state funds as required.
Avoid common mistakes such as incorrect Social Security numbers, missed signatures, and failing to check that all income sources are accurately reported. Double-check calculations for accuracy.
Processing times can vary, but on average it may take around 4-6 weeks for Utah to process your income tax return, depending on the volume of submissions and accuracy of your form.
